In this thesis,we first give a brief introduction to some background knowledge about the theory of branching processes.We introduce the definition of a branching process,the generating function,the relation between the extinction probability and the expectation of the progeny and how to distinguish irreducible processes from reducible ones.In two-type cases,we give details about the construction of a branching tree and the connection between a branching tree and a random walk.Furthermore,the tree of mutants obtained from the original tree is proposed,as well as the connection between these two trees.We focus on the total progeny of different types for critical or subcritical cases,whose distribution has been solved in reducible two-type cases.We give the distribution in irreducible two-type cases.Then according to the distribution of leaves in single type branching processes,the similar distribution is presented in two-type cases.Finally,we state the property of the distribution of the number of particles having at most(k1,k2)children in two-type branching processes knowing the similar property in single type cases.
